Market Projections and Forecast

According to Persistence Market Research’s projections, the global wind power equipment market size is anticipated to rise from US$ 49.9 billion in 2025 to US$ 78.6 billion by 2032. It is projected to witness a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 6.7% between 2025 and 2032.

This growth trajectory is fueled by increasing investments in renewable energy infrastructure, advancements in wind turbine technologies, and the expansion of offshore wind projects. Europe and Asia-Pacific are expected to lead the market, with rapid installations supported by government subsidies, ambitious renewable energy targets, and strong private sector participation. North America is also projected to see significant adoption, particularly in the United States, where wind power is becoming an essential part of the national energy mix.

Market Dynamics

Drivers of Market Growth

  1. Rising Global Energy Demand and Decarbonization Goals
    With global electricity consumption steadily rising, governments and organizations are prioritizing renewable energy to meet demand sustainably. Wind power is a cost-effective and scalable solution, and the growing focus on achieving net-zero carbon emissions by 2050 is accelerating the adoption of wind power equipment worldwide.
  2. Government Incentives and Policies
    Subsidies, tax incentives, and renewable energy mandates are major drivers of the wind power equipment market. Policies such as feed-in tariffs, renewable portfolio standards, and green investment programs encourage both public and private investments in wind energy projects, making the sector more attractive.
  3. Technological Advancements in Wind Turbines
    Innovation in turbine design, including larger blades, advanced composites, and smart monitoring systems, has significantly improved efficiency and lowered the levelized cost of electricity (LCOE). These advancements enable turbines to capture more energy at lower wind speeds, broadening the applicability of wind power across geographies.
  4. Expansion of Offshore Wind Projects
    Offshore wind farms are gaining momentum due to their ability to harness stronger and more consistent wind resources. Equipment designed for offshore projects, such as high-capacity turbines and floating platforms, is witnessing increased demand, particularly in regions like Europe, the United States, and China.

Challenges in the Market

  1. High Initial Investment and Infrastructure Costs
    Despite falling costs of wind power generation, the initial setup of wind farms—including land acquisition, equipment, and grid integration—remains capital-intensive. These costs can be prohibitive in developing economies with limited financial resources.
  2. Environmental and Social Concerns
    While wind power is clean, concerns such as noise pollution, impact on bird and bat populations, and land use conflicts continue to pose challenges. Addressing these concerns through better design, planning, and stakeholder engagement is crucial for long-term sustainability.
  3. Supply Chain Disruptions
    The wind power equipment industry is vulnerable to supply chain disruptions, particularly in critical components such as blades and gearboxes. The COVID-19 pandemic highlighted these vulnerabilities, and ongoing geopolitical tensions and material shortages remain risks.

Market Trends and Technological Innovations

  1. Larger and More Efficient Turbines
    The industry trend is moving toward larger turbines capable of producing higher output. Offshore wind farms, in particular, are adopting turbines with capacities exceeding 14 MW, which improve efficiency and reduce project costs per megawatt.
  2. Digitalization and Predictive Maintenance
    Smart sensors, IoT, and AI-driven monitoring systems are being integrated into wind equipment to optimize performance, predict failures, and minimize downtime. Predictive maintenance reduces operational costs and extends the lifespan of turbines.
  3. Floating Offshore Wind Farms
    Floating platforms for offshore wind turbines are enabling installations in deeper waters where wind resources are stronger. This innovation is expected to unlock significant growth opportunities in regions with limited shallow coastal areas.
  4. Focus on Sustainability and Circular Economy
    Manufacturers are increasingly focusing on recyclable turbine blades and sustainable materials to address environmental concerns. The development of fully recyclable wind blades is a significant step toward reducing waste in the industry.

Regional Analysis

North America
North America is witnessing robust growth in wind power installations, particularly in the United States, where wind energy is becoming a vital component of the energy mix. Federal and state-level policies, along with significant investments in offshore wind projects along the East Coast, are driving the market forward. Canada is also expanding its wind capacity, especially in provinces with favorable wind conditions.

Europe
Europe remains the global leader in wind power adoption, with countries like Germany, the U.K., Denmark, and Spain spearheading both onshore and offshore projects. The European Union’s Green Deal and net-zero targets are expected to accelerate investments, with offshore wind being a key focus. Advanced manufacturing capabilities and strong government support further bolster Europe’s leadership.

Asia-Pacific
The Asia-Pacific region is projected to register the fastest growth, led by China, India, and Japan. China dominates global wind power installations, with massive investments in both onshore and offshore projects. India is rapidly scaling up wind power capacity as part of its renewable energy targets, while Japan is investing in offshore projects to diversify its energy mix. Rising urbanization and industrialization across Asia are also increasing demand for clean energy.

Middle East & Africa
Although still in its early stages, the Middle East and Africa are showing growing interest in wind energy. Countries like South Africa and Morocco are making strides in renewable adoption, while Gulf nations are beginning to explore wind power as part of their broader clean energy diversification efforts.
